"But that doesn't necessarily mean the "natural flavors" in your blueberry granola bar are simply crushed-up blueberries.
Rather, they probably consist of a chemical originally found in blueberries, enhanced and added into your food in a lab.
...
And all of the extra ingredients in flavors often aren't as innocent as you'd hope they would be.
"The mixture will often have
some solvent and preservatives — and that makes up 80 to 90 percent of the volume [of the flavoring]. In the end product, it's a small amount, but it still has artificial ingredients," Andrews says. ""
